Full Job Description

## Accountabilities Develop high-impact research and thought leadership on audit data analytics, creating actionable insights, frameworks, and best practices for senior risk and audit leaders. Analyze market trends, emerging technologies, and industry shifts to produce forward-looking guidance for global organizations. Conduct deep analytical work to identify root causes of client challenges and translate findings into strategic recommendations. Deliver presentations, briefings, and advisory sessions to senior stakeholders in both virtual and in-person settings. Contribute to content development, peer review, and refinement of research outputs within a global analyst community. Support sales and client engagement efforts by providing subject matter expertise and market insights that strengthen client relationships. Mentor junior analysts and contribute to improving research methodologies, processes, and delivery standards. Represent the organization’s research perspective at conferences, industry events, and executive forums. Requirements: 10+ years of relevant professional experience, including strong exposure to internal audit, data analytics, or risk functions. At least 3 years of direct experience in data analytics within internal audit, and 7+ years in audit or related risk/data roles. Proven thought leadership in audit analytics strategy, including development of frameworks, governance models, and advanced analytics capabilities. Strong understanding of risk domains such as cybersecurity, cloud security, governance, resilience, third-party risk, and data protection. Exceptional analytical skills with the ability to synthesize complex data, identify patterns, and deliver structured insights. Strong research and writing capabilities, with experience producing executive-level content and strategic recommendations. Excellent communication and presentation skills, with confidence engaging senior stakeholders and large audiences. Strong business and financial acumen
